Although Pastor Terry Jones has dropped his threat to burn Korans on the anniversary of the 9/11 terrorist attacks, President Obama said today he is fearful of copycats looking to get their turn in the spotlight.

“Although this might be one individual in Florida, part of my concern is that we don’t start having a whole bunch of people across America thinking this is a way to get attention,” Obama said at a press conference today. “This is a way to endanger our troops…you don’t play games with that.”

Jones reaffirmed today that he no longer plans to go through with his Koran-burning ceremony. But several other religious leaders across the nation say they’ll go ahead with their own.
